How to do it

the tool · the steps · what to avoid
  1. 1

    Log in to the Adobe Acrobat Sign web portal as an account or group admin.

  2. 2

    Navigate to the Account or Group settings area, depending on whether you want to configure settings at the account or group level.

  3. 3

    Select Send Settings from the navigation menu.

  4. 4

    Locate the Send in Bulk or Send in Bulk (SiB) section.

  5. 5

    Enable or disable the bulk send feature for the account or specific group by toggling the appropriate setting.

    CautionDisabling bulk send at the account level will prevent all users from accessing this feature.

  6. 6

    To restrict access to specific users or groups, assign users to groups with the desired bulk send permissions.

    Best practiceUse groups to manage permissions efficiently when you have multiple users with different bulk send needs.

  7. 7

    Adjust any additional bulk send settings, such as recipient restrictions or sending limits, as required for compliance or organizational policy.

    Best practiceFor best deliverability, consider limiting the number of bulk sends per hour to avoid email blacklisting.

  8. 8

    Save your changes before exiting the settings area.

You can manage which users or groups have access to bulk send features directly from the admin console under Send Settings.

This runs in the Acrobat app - there is no separate API for this task.

Bulk Send lets you send one document to many people at the same time for their e-signatures. Instead of sending each document separately, you create one main document (a parent template), and Bulk Send creates up to 1,000 unique copies (child agreements) for your signers. This saves a lot of time when you have many people who need to sign the same document.

  1. After choosing 'Send in bulk', you can add recipients manually by typing their names and emails.
  2. For many recipients, upload a CSV file. This file can also set roles, authentication, and pre-fill fields for each signer.

Each document sent with Bulk Send is a 'child agreement' that is unique to one signer. It has its own audit trail, which means Adobe tracks all actions related to that specific document. This ensures legal validity and privacy for each signer, but it also means each child agreement counts separately against your total transaction limits for your Adobe Acrobat plan.

No, when you use Bulk Send, each signer receives their own independent 'child agreement'. They do not see who else received the document or any information about other signers. This keeps all signing processes private and secure.

FeatureOne Document to Multiple SignersBulk Send
PurposeMultiple people sign the *same single document* in a specific order or all at once.Send *many copies of the same document* to many individual signers.
AgreementsOne agreement, one audit trail.Up to 1,000 independent child agreements, each with its own audit trail.
Signer ViewSigners might see other signers' names/emails depending on settings.Signers do not see each other; each signing is private.
Use CaseTeam approval for one project, contract with multiple parties.Sending waivers to a large group, collecting consent forms from many customers.
